Beschreibung
In an increasingly digital world, excessive screen exposure among school children has emerged as a growing educational, psychological, and social concern. This book explores the behavioural dimensions of screen dependency among Indian school children while examining the role of data analytics in understanding digital habits and intervention outcomes. Bringing together interdisciplinary perspectives from education, psychology, behavioural science, and analytics, the volume discusses digital wellness, screen-time management, parental influence, school-based interventions, and policy implications in the Indian context. The book offers evidence-based insights and practical strategies for educators, researchers, parents, and policymakers seeking to promote healthier digital engagement among children.
